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2005.02.20;
Скачать: [xml.tar.bz2];

Вниз

Подключение к Oracle.   Найти похожие ветки 

 
ora_user   (2005-01-14 15:47) [0]

День добрый! Помогите начинающему, пожалуйста. Если можно по шагам, как подключиться к базе Oracle и увидеть в Grid-e таблицу. До этого пробовал работать только с файл-серверными (*.dbf) таблицами. Если вам трудно, хотябы ссылку киньте.
Спасибо.


 
Sergey13 ©   (2005-01-14 15:50) [1]

2ora_user   (14.01.05 15:47)
Да в общем то принципиально разницы никакой dbf или Oracle.


 
ora_user   (2005-01-14 15:54) [2]

[1]
Пробовал также, как к dbf-ам подклачаться, не вижу никаких данных. Хотя вижу, что соединение установлено.


 
ora_user   (2005-01-14 16:12) [3]

Ребята, я понимаю, "орехи" дают почву для дикуссий (Scained ©   (14.01.05 00:09) ), ну, пожалуста, уделите внимание и моей проблеме. Конечно, есть книги (скажете), но именно такой у меня нет.


 
ora_user   (2005-01-14 16:39) [4]

Огромное всем спасибо!!!


 
vlad_ri   (2005-01-14 16:46) [5]

1. Установить и настроить ODAC (брать на сайте Оракла или на установочных дисках Оракла (не забыть проставить провайдер Ole DB), последняя версия кажеться ODAC10g )
2. При создании ConnectionString указать "Oracle Provider for OleDB", в качестве DataSource укажите "имя конфигурации" заданое вами при настройке ODAC, не забудьте задать "User name"  и "Password"
3. Примерчик: Provider=OraOLEDB.Oracle.1;Persist Security Info=False;User ID=YourUser;Password=YourPassword;Data Source=YourSource

PS: Самое сложное здесь разобраться с настройкой ODAC, ну не сложно но если первый раз то нужно быть ВНИМЕТЕЛЬНЫМ :)


 
vlad_ri   (2005-01-14 16:47) [6]

Удалено модератором
Примечание: дубль


 
vlad_ri   (2005-01-14 16:48) [7]

Удалено модератором
Примечание: дубль


 
vlad_ri   (2005-01-14 17:01) [8]

Извините за флуд, глюк какойто с сеткой был :(


 
Sergey13 ©   (2005-01-17 09:19) [9]

2[8] vlad_ri   (14.01.05 17:01)
>Извините за флуд, глюк какойто с сеткой был :(
Похоже у тебя не только с сеткой глюк. 8-)

2[2] ora_user   (14.01.05 15:54)
> Хотя вижу, что соединение установлено.
Из чего это видно? Какие компоненты используешь для доступа?


 
Erik1 ©   (2005-01-17 13:51) [10]

И какой инструмент для работы с Oracle TOAD или SQL Developer?


 
Sergey13 ©   (2005-01-17 13:58) [11]

2[10] Erik1 ©   (17.01.05 13:51)
Указано D6.


 
Danilka ©   (2005-01-17 14:07) [12]

Вапще-то, автор 3 дня назад спрашивал.. :)


 
Sergey13 ©   (2005-01-17 14:09) [13]

2[12] Danilka ©   (17.01.05 14:07)
Думаешь подключился уже и кайфует? 8-)


 
Danilka ©   (2005-01-17 14:17) [14]

[13] Sergey13 ©   (17.01.05 14:09)
Хотелось-бы надеятся, учитывая что больше не появляется. :)


 
ora_user   (2005-01-18 11:49) [15]

[13]
Да нет не кайфую, просто уже не надеялся на ответы, только сейчас зашел снова  на форум.
[9]
> Какие компоненты используешь для доступа?
Использую компоненты: TSQLConnection, TSQLTable, TDBGrid


 
vlad_ri   (2005-01-18 12:01) [16]

2 ora_user   (18.01.05 11:49) [15]

А в чём проблема?


 
ora_user   (2005-01-18 12:12) [17]

Извините, у меня нет возможности постоянно быть на форуме...
С Oracle сложность еще в том, что сервер не постоянно влючен, у нас (на предприятии) только начинают его изучать, установлен на другом этаже, на машине начальника (под Linux-ом), и естественно он (начальник) включит на время, пробуйте, затем загружается в своей системе и получить доступ и работать нет возможности постоянно. Да, дурдом, ну что делать... Так вот приходиться на "пальцах" изучать.


 
ora_user   (2005-01-18 12:15) [18]

[16]
В DBGride не вижу ничего. Может я кардинально не то делаю, направьте на путь истинный, пожалуйста.


 
vlad_ri   (2005-01-18 12:18) [19]

если есть ICQ стучитесь - 346705638


 
Sergey13 ©   (2005-01-18 13:05) [20]

2[18] ora_user   (18.01.05 12:15)
>В DBGride не вижу ничего.
Так может там и нет ничего?

>Может я кардинально не то делаю, направьте на путь истинный, пожалуйста.
Может. Но что бы направить надо знать каким путем ты уже шел.


 
ora_user   (2005-01-18 14:37) [21]

[20]
>надо знать каким путем ты уже шел.
На моей машине установлен клиент Oracle, в Delphi на форму "накидал" DBGrid1, SQLConnection1, SQLTable1, DBGrid1, SQLDataSet1. В инспекторе объектов, как положено назначил... Ну дело в том, это было 4 дня назад, после этого мне администратор переустанавливал систему (у нас это даже не дают делать) и как сейчас глянул, он забыл доустановить клиента Oracle. В общем сейчас даже не могу сказать, что смогу увидеть...


 
Sergey13 ©   (2005-01-18 14:44) [22]

2[21] ora_user   (18.01.05 14:37)
>В инспекторе объектов, как положено назначил...
Многоточие переведи. Что назначил и чему.


 
Danilka ©   (2005-01-18 14:45) [23]

[21] ora_user   (18.01.05 14:37)
Когда поставишь клиента, настроишь, попробуешь соединиться, если выдаст ошибку, надо проанализировать текст ошибки и ее код, если сам не смогешь - кидай сюда.
А если ошибок не будет, но в гриде будет пусто, то, это из-за того, что слишком мало компонентов накидал - не хватает DataSource именно через него грид получает данные из датасета или таблицы. :)


 
ora_user   (2005-01-18 15:02) [24]

[23]
DataSource есть, Table в true становится, но в гриде нет ничего (вернее небыло, т. к. в данный момент нет клиента).


 
Sergey13 ©   (2005-01-18 15:13) [25]

2[24] ora_user   (18.01.05 15:02)
Так таблица пустая. Нет?

ЗЫ: Вообще плюнут бы ты на Table.


 
ora_user   (2005-01-18 15:21) [26]

[25]
> ЗЫ: Вообще плюнут бы ты на Table.
А что использовать вместо?


 
ora_user   (2005-01-18 15:30) [27]

Имеется в виду Query вместо Table? Без этих компонентов не знаю как еще.


 
Sergey13 ©   (2005-01-18 15:36) [28]

2[27] ora_user   (18.01.05 15:30)
>Имеется в виду Query вместо Table?
Угу.


 
ora_user   (2005-01-18 15:42) [29]

[28]
OK! Но сегодня не смогу ничего, подожду когда установят по новой клиента.
Спасибо всем!



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2005.02.20;
Скачать: [xml.tar.bz2];

Наверх




Память: 0.51 MB
Время: 0.041 c
4-1104671073
lexusU
2005-01-02 16:04
2005.02.20
Как зарегистрировать и запустить/остановить службу?


3-1106654671
atruhin
2005-01-25 15:04
2005.02.20
Как в FIB настроить нестандартный номер порта коннекта


9-1100511944
Xenon
2004-11-15 12:45
2005.02.20
Скролл экрана


9-1100363056
Creep
2004-11-13 19:24
2005.02.20
Округления GLFloat


14-1106595804
вла-ди-мир
2005-01-24 22:43
2005.02.20
Старые ПК в добрые руки





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ский